Sky should have taken over my line yesterday, according to my letter from BT, but I'm not convinced it happened.

When I was BT, I didn't have 1571 but asked to have it with Sky. But when I dial 1571 I hear a recorded message: "This line does not have a call answering service."

Is there a test number I can phone to be certain I'm no longer with BT? I'm not going to be making any chargeable calls until I'm sure.

Edit: Just phoned 150 and heard "Thanks for calling BT." My line transfer didn't take place.

I thought this was supposed to be simple.

Called Sky on Saturday because my line still hadn't been switched over, but according to their systems switchover had taken place as planned on Friday 13th.

I explained that I was still hearing a BT announcement when I dialled 150 but was told that that wasn't proof that my line was still with BT! What?

Unfortunately there was a half-hour wait on the phone if I wanted to be put through to Technical Help, but as I was at work I had to hang up.

However, this morning on dialling 150 I get "Welcome to Sky, the home of HD TV." So switchover has finally taken place.

I know Sky come in for a lot of flack on these forums, some of it justified, I'm sure, but in my experience the agents are always polite, if not entirely clued up at times. And I got through to a UK call centre.

Verdict: A relatively small blip. My experience could have been far worse. Recommended.
